Lack of access to midstream infrastructure poses challenge to Mexico's deepwater development

The 2013-14 energy reform legislation placed great emphasis upon the upstream sector but failed to establish a regulatory regime that would allow access to Pemex's legacy infrastructure. The missing regime would have been based on the principle of open access with transparent tolling arrangements that would require the point of sale of natural gas to be at the tailgate of the processing plant. The details of how the midstream is supposed to work for CNH operators were left unclear by the previous administration. In the list of areas of responsibility for CRE, gas processing does not appear.
